Statistics for Nursing Research: A Workbook for Evidence-Based Practice, 3rd Edition (Original PDF)
- Comprehensive coverage
 
- and extensive exercise practice address all common techniques of sampling, measurement, and statistical analysis that you are likely to see in nursing and health sciences literature.
 - Literature-based approach uses key excerpts from published studies to reinforce learning through practical application.
 - 36 sampling, measurement, and statistical analysis exercises provide a practical review of both basic and advanced statistical techniques.
 - Study Questions in each chapter help you apply concepts to an actual literature appraisal.
 - Questions to Be Graded sections in each chapter help assess your mastery of key statistical techniques.
 - Consistent format for all chapters enhances learning and enables quick review.
